H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E C. PRAVEEN KUMAR WRIT PETITION No. 39684 of 2018 ORDER:

1) Heard. Since this Court is not going into merits of the case, the writ petition is disposed of without giving notice to the unofficial respondent.

2) The present writ petition came to be filed seeking issuance of writ of mandamus declaring the action of respondent No.1 in not taking appropriate action against respondent No.3, preventing her from constructing the house without obtaining building permission in the land admeasuring Ac.0.50 cents situated in Survey No.93/1 of Vedayapalem, Nellore District, as illegal and arbitrary.

3) The learned counsel for the petitioner would submit that the petitioner made a representation bringing to the notice of the first respondent, the illegal constructions said to have been made by respondent No.3 and that no action has been taken up on the said representation. But, however, he failed to file a copy of the said representation.

4) Having regard to the above, the writ petition is disposed of directing the petitioner to make a fresh representation to the authorities seeking action to be taken against respondent No.3 for the illegal constructions alleged to have been made in the above said land, in which event, the authorities concerned shall deal with the same in accordance

with law, after hearing the petitioner and the unofficial respondent, as early as possible.

5) Miscellaneous petitions, pending if any, shall stand closed in the light of this final order. No order as to costs. ______________________________ JUSTICE C. PRAVEEN KUMAR 05.11.2018 vhb
